What Causes Allergy? Helper T cells (Th cells) help orchestrate the immune response to develop the right kinds of weapons for the invading pathogens. For example, Th1 cells fight against bacteria and viruses, Th2 cells fight against parasites, and Th17 cells fight against some yeasts and bacteria. Regulatory T cells (Treg) cells are also a […]
